This is your – the lens that cuts through the noise of endless streaming libraries to bring you a single, focused recommendation. This Week’s Zoom Target: The Holdovers (2023) Why the zoom? Because subtlety is rare, and this film is a masterclass in it.
Set in a snow-glued 1970s New England boarding school, a grumpy classics professor (Paul Giamatti in career-best form) is forced to babysit the handful of students with nowhere to go over Christmas break. What follows is not a plot—it’s a slow, warm thaw.
